rug delivery to the colon is beneficial not only for the oral delivery of proteins and peptide drugs (degraded by digestive enzymes of stomach and small intestine) but also for the delivery of low molecular weight compounds used to treat diseases associated with the colon or large intestine such as ulcerative colitis, diarrhea, and colon cancer. In addition, the colon has a long retention time and appears highly responsive to agents that enhance the absorption of poorly absorbed drugs. The approaches used in the colonic delivery of drugs include the use of prodrugs (1), pH-sensitive polymer coatings (2, 3), time-dependent formulations (4), bacterialdegradable coatings (5), time pH-controlled deliveries (6), and intestinal luminal pressure-controlled colon delivery capsules (7). In addition, the use of biodegradable polymers such as azopolymers and polysaccharides (e.g., pectins and dextrans) for colon targeting has also been described in the literature (8, 9). Several publications have described drug-containing microspheres using the Eudragit (Rohm Pharma) series of polymers as the encapsulating materials (10, 11). The Eudragits are a family of polymers based on acrylic and methacrylic acids suitable for use in orally administered drug delivery systems. These polymers are available in various grades possessing a range of physicochemical properties. Some dissolve rapidly at clearly defined pH values, whereas two grades, Eudragit RL and RS, are insoluble in aqueous media but permeable, and as such have been shown to be suitable for sustained-release microencapsulated dosage forms. The permeability of Eudragit RL and RS to aqueous solutions results from the presence of quaternary ammonium groups in their structure; RL has a higher proportion of these groups and as such is more permeable than RS. In recent years, microsphere dosage forms have gained increasing importance as oral controlled drug delivery systems. These systems present several advantages in comparison to unit dosage forms such as more predictable gastric emptying and less local irritation (12). Microsphere systems also minimize the possible intestinal retention of undigested polymer materials in chronic dosing (13). As part of a research program to investigate the controlled and targeted delivery of drugs to the colon, Eudragit RL polymer (ERLP) microspheres containing albendazole were prepared.
